As long as it isn't green/blue then its just steam of the rad. TADTS 
If you suddenly can't see then the rad has gone bang or a hose has come off. Worth checking the jubilee clips are done up on the rad hoses as I assume the build quality on the S2s is to the same awesome standard as the S1s
